System Proxy Switcher—frequently utilized via standalone tools or popular browser extensions like Proxy Switcher and Manager and Switcher for Firefox—is a utility designed to bypass tedious manual network configurations by allowing users to toggle between different proxy profiles instantly. Instead of digging into complex operating system menus every time you change environments, this tool brings one-click network management directly to your fingertips. Key Features

One-Click Toggling: Instantly swap network modes (e.g., Direct Connection, System Proxy, or Manual Proxy).

Visual Mode Indicators: Color-coded toolbar badge icons shift dynamically (e.g., red for direct traffic, green for system proxy) to tell you your status at a glance.

Smart Split Tunneling & Whitelisting: Set up rules or Proxy Auto-Config (PAC) files to route specific domains through a proxy while keeping local traffic direct.

Session Persistence: Saves your selected network states even after you close your browser or application.

Keyboard Shortcut Support: Use quick hotkeys to cycle through proxy configurations without ever opening a settings panel. Standard Network Modes Comparison

Proxy switchers usually operate across these primary configurations: Network Mode Traffic Route Best Used For Direct Connection (No Proxy) Directly via local Internet Service Provider (ISP). Trusted local networks, maximum raw speeds. System Proxy Inherits settings from your core OS configuration. Corporate environments or globally forced VPNs. Manual Proxy Routes data through a custom IP address and port.
